Construction is progressing on the Jeddah Tower (Saudi Arabia), which, once completed, is set to become the tallest building in the world. The tower will surpass Dubai’s Burj Khalifa since it is planned to rise over a kilometer (about 3,280 feet). The structure will feature residential, commercial, and office spaces, as well as a luxury hotel and the world’s highest observation deck. It will also serve as the centerpiece of the $20 billion Jeddah Economic City project, a large-scale redevelopment formerly known as Kingdom City.
The ambitious design is being led by Chicago-based architects Adrian Smith and Gordon Gill of AS+GG Architecture. Partner Robert Forest shared with Newsweek that the team is targeting an August 2028 completion date. While the firm has not yet disclosed the tower’s exact final height or floor count, it confirmed that the structure will include more than 130 stories. Forest noted that construction is now in full swing and that the atmosphere on-site is “robust,” with the team deeply committed to bringing this iconic vision to life for Saudi Arabia.
Work on the Jeddah Tower originally began in 2013 but came to a halt in 2018 following a series of high-profile arrests during Saudi Arabia’s 2017–2019 anti-corruption purge. Furthermore, the COVID-19 pandemic added further setbacks, pushing the project’s timeline back. However, according to Dezeen, construction officially resumed in September 2023. Once finished, the skyscraper will stand roughly 564 feet taller than the Burj Khalifa, claiming the title of the world’s tallest building.
Architecturally, the Jeddah Tower embraces a striking neo-futuristic style characterized by its sleek, spire-like form. The design draws inspiration from the natural shape of palm fronds; a symbol deeply rooted in Saudi culture. It should be noted that the tower’s geometry was developed to optimize wind resistance representing growth and technological innovation. In all, this fusion of symbolism and engineering aims to embody both the natural beauty and forward-looking ambitions of the Kingdom.
